Early in the morning, tragedy struck near Lalbaug in Mumbai as a speeding car rammed into two senior citizens during their routine morning walk. The incident took place on Dr. Babasaheb Ambedkar Road, a bustling area known for its morning walkers and joggers.

The Morning Walk Routine Turned Fatal

Vitthal Kadam, aged 66, and his companion Pandurang Matare had been following their daily morning walk routine at Shahid Bhagat Singh Maidan in Kalachowki. However, due to a government event taking place at the maidan, they had to alter their route and walk along the adjoining roads that fateful morning.

The Tragic Collision

As the two friends were walking along the road towards Parel, a Swift Dzire coming from Parel towards Byculla lost control and struck them with great force. The impact was so severe that both Kadam and Matare sustained serious injuries. Kadam, upon regaining consciousness, found Matare lying unconscious a short distance away, while the car had collided with two other vehicles.

Rapid Response and Fatal Outcome

Bystanders immediately alerted the Kalachowki police, who swiftly arrived at the scene. Matare was rushed to KEM Hospital for urgent medical attention. Despite the best efforts of the medical team, Matare succumbed to his injuries later that day. The police noted that Matare had suffered a deep head injury in the accident.

Driver Apprehended and Confession

The driver of the Swift Dzire, identified as Santosh Kashinath Shedkar, was arrested following the incident. Shedkar, a local resident who had recently returned from a trip, confessed to losing control of his vehicle due to fatigue. He appeared in court and has been remanded in judicial custody. Shedkar, who runs a business making nameplates, admitted to falling asleep at the wheel, leading to the tragic accident.
